Tips for Enjoying Your Tour in Fiji

Malolo Island Resort is a holiday village on Mamanuca Islands. The village encourages the guests to pay more attention to their families by reducing the Wi-Fi coverage.

Castaway Island Fiji is also located on Mamanuca Islands. The owner hopes that guests could focus more on the seaside scenery and thus does not give them the chance to watch TV or use Wi-Fi in their rooms.

Koro Sun Resort is a good choice for your relaxing journey on Vanua Levu, and it is encircled by palm trees. Matava Eco Resort sits on Kadavu and it is characterized by environmental protection. Wi-Fi use is restricted and guests are encouraged to get closer to nature.

Shangri-La's Fijian Resort & Spa is situated on the Coral Coast. Right here, guests who plan to watch the sunset and improve their wellness are forbidden from carrying phones. In this case, everyone will pay more attention to nature, enjoy the time together with their beloved ones and learn more about the Bula spirit.

Tips for the Cultural Experiences in Fiji

Lailai Adventure Club of Nanuku Auberge Resort is different from traditional children's clubs. Here children will have the chance to immerse themselves when exploring nature and Fiji's traditional culture. They can have a better understanding of the local culture by respecting and abiding by the traditional customs. The club holds diverse cultural activities for kids to choose from and the participators could try Fiji's traditional cooking, enjoy the Meke Dance, weave flower baskets, light the way with flaming torches at night, tell stories to each other, remove the coconut shells, make garlands, take classes on Fiji's languages, listen to the Fijian music, plant rice and build rafts.

Six Senses Fiji gives your children the chance to join the global initiative of" Growing with Six Senses". The program incorporates the six dimensions of wellness (social, environmental, physical, spiritual, emotional and intellectual), so kids can discover their true self and reconnect with nature and others around.

Bula Club is part of Jean-Michel Cousteau Resort Fiji and it has been awarded many times for its commitment to children. The club holds various self-exploration and education activities for kids and encourages them to explore nature and broaden their horizon so that they will learn more about themselves and the environment.
